Why Nashville Weather Demands Careful Material Selection

Middle Tennessee sits in USDA hardiness zone 6b to 7a, which means winter lows between 0 and 10 degrees Fahrenheit and summer highs regularly above 90. More importantly, the region experiences an average of 30 to 40 freeze-thaw cycles each winter.

A freeze-thaw cycle occurs when temperatures drop below 32 degrees at night and rise above freezing during the day. Water trapped in porous materials expands when it freezes, creating internal pressure. When it thaws, the material contracts. This repeated expansion and contraction cracks weak or improperly installed materials.

Nashville also receives about 48 inches of rain annually, distributed fairly evenly throughout the year. This constant moisture exposure means your patio material must handle water absorption without degrading, staining, or becoming slippery.

Concrete Pavers

Concrete pavers rank among the best patio materials Nashville installers recommend for freeze-thaw durability and design flexibility. High-quality pavers manufactured to ASTM C936 standards feature compressive strengths above 8,000 psi, making them significantly stronger than poured concrete.

The key advantage is their segmental design. Individual pavers can shift slightly with ground movement without cracking. Joints filled with polymeric sand allow drainage while preventing weed growth and insect intrusion.

Thickness and Density Matter

For residential patios, choose pavers at least 2.375 inches thick. Thinner pavers crack more easily under freeze-thaw stress. Density is equally important. Pavers with absorption rates below four percent resist water penetration that causes freeze damage.

Concrete pavers come in hundreds of colors, textures, and patterns. You can replicate natural stone looks at a fraction of the cost, or choose modern geometric designs. Quality pavers include UV-stable pigments that resist fading under Tennessee’s intense summer sun.

Pro Tip: Always install pavers over a proper base of four to six inches of compacted gravel, topped with one inch of bedding sand. Base preparation determines 80 percent of long-term patio performance.

Natural Stone

Natural stone offers unmatched beauty and, when properly selected, exceptional durability for Nashville’s climate. Not all stone performs equally in freeze-thaw conditions. The critical factor is absorption rate, measured as the percentage of water the stone absorbs relative to its dry weight.

Bluestone and Granite

Bluestone and granite feature absorption rates typically below one percent, making them highly resistant to freeze damage. Bluestone’s natural cleft surface provides excellent slip resistance even when wet. Granite offers similar durability with a wider range of colors from grays to reds and blacks.

Both materials handle Nashville’s temperature swings without cracking or spalling. Their density also resists staining from leaves, pollen, and other organic debris common in our region.

Flagstone Considerations

Flagstone encompasses various sedimentary stones including sandstone and limestone. While beautiful, these materials absorb more water than bluestone or granite. Absorption rates often range from two to six percent.

In Nashville, choose only flagstone rated for freeze-thaw applications. Applying a penetrating sealer every two to three years helps protect against moisture infiltration. Proper installation over a drainage base is non-negotiable with flagstone.

Natural stone typically costs 50 to 150 percent more than concrete pavers, but the investment delivers a truly one-of-a-kind appearance. No two stones are identical, creating visual interest that manufactured products cannot replicate.

Porcelain Pavers

Porcelain pavers represent newer technology gaining traction as one of the best patio materials Nashville designers specify for high-performance applications. Manufactured at temperatures exceeding 2,200 degrees Fahrenheit, porcelain pavers achieve nearly zero water absorption, typically below 0.5 percent.

This extreme density makes porcelain virtually immune to freeze-thaw damage. The material will not crack, chip, or spall from ice formation. Porcelain also resists staining from oils, wine, rust, and organic matter far better than natural stone or concrete.

Design Versatility

Modern porcelain pavers replicate wood, natural stone, concrete, and even fabric textures with remarkable accuracy. Digital printing technology creates realistic veining, color variation, and surface texture. You get the look of exotic materials without the maintenance headaches.

Porcelain comes in large format sizes, including 24×24 inches and even 12×48 inch plank formats. Fewer joints mean faster installation and a cleaner contemporary aesthetic that complements modern architecture common in areas like Brentwood and Franklin.

The material stays cooler underfoot than concrete or stone in summer heat because it reflects rather than absorbs solar radiation. This makes porcelain an excellent choice around pool areas where bare feet are common.

Cost runs similar to premium natural stone, but minimal maintenance requirements offset the initial investment. Porcelain never needs sealing and cleans easily with just water.

Stamped and Poured Concrete

Poured concrete remains popular for larger patio areas due to lower initial cost. Modern stamping techniques create patterns that mimic stone, brick, or tile. When properly installed with control joints and adequate reinforcement, concrete can last 20 to 30 years in Nashville’s climate.

The challenge with poured concrete lies in its monolithic nature. Unlike segmental pavers, concrete slabs cannot flex with minor ground movement. Cracks often develop within the first few years, especially if the base settles unevenly.

Critical Installation Factors

Concrete thickness should reach at least four inches for residential patios, with six inches preferred for areas near outdoor kitchens or heavy furniture. Reinforcement with rebar or welded wire fabric distributes stress and minimizes cracking.

Control joints must be cut every eight to ten feet in both directions to direct cracking to predetermined locations. These joints accommodate thermal expansion and contraction that occurs with seasonal temperature changes.

Air entrainment is essential for freeze-thaw resistance. The concrete mix should include five to eight percent entrained air, creating microscopic bubbles that give water room to expand when frozen. This single factor determines whether concrete survives or fails after multiple Nashville winters.

Stamped concrete requires resealing every two to three years to maintain color and protect the surface. Without proper maintenance, the finish degrades and moisture penetrates, leading to surface spalling where the top layer flakes off.

Key Takeaway: Poured concrete offers the lowest upfront cost but demands the most ongoing maintenance and accepts the highest long-term crack risk compared to segmental paver systems.

Travertine

Travertine delivers a Mediterranean aesthetic popular in upscale outdoor living spaces. This natural limestone forms around mineral springs, creating characteristic porous texture and warm earth tones ranging from ivory to rust.

The material’s porosity presents both advantages and challenges in Nashville’s climate. The surface stays relatively cool in summer because air pockets insulate against heat absorption. The natural texture provides good slip resistance.

However, absorption rates typically range from two to five percent, making travertine vulnerable to freeze-thaw damage if not properly sealed and maintained. Water that penetrates the stone’s pores can freeze, causing surface pitting and edge chipping.

Filled vs. Unfilled

Travertine comes in filled or unfilled formats. Filled travertine has factory-applied resin filling the natural pores, creating a smoother surface with better stain resistance. Unfilled travertine retains its natural texture but requires more frequent sealing.

For Nashville applications, filled travertine performs better. Plan to apply a penetrating sealer annually before winter to protect against freeze damage. This maintenance requirement exceeds that of denser stone options but remains manageable for homeowners committed to the material’s unique appearance.

Brick Pavers

Clay brick pavers offer timeless appeal and proven durability when manufactured to proper specifications. Not all brick works for patios. You need pavers specifically rated for severe weathering, designated SW in brick grading systems.

SW-rated brick features absorption rates below six percent and compressive strength exceeding 8,000 psi. This combination handles freeze-thaw cycles without crumbling or spalling. The clay is fired at higher temperatures than common building brick, creating a denser, more weather-resistant product.

Brick’s color runs through the entire unit rather than just the surface, so chips and wear remain less visible than with surface-colored concrete pavers. The material develops a patina over time that many homeowners find appealing.

Installation follows similar base preparation to concrete pavers. Proper drainage and compacted gravel base prevent settling and keep brick level. Polymeric sand joints lock pavers together while allowing minor movement.

Brick costs fall between concrete pavers and natural stone. The classic look complements traditional architecture common throughout Hendersonville and Lebanon.

What About Composite Decking for Patios

Some homeowners consider composite decking as a patio surface, particularly for raised applications. While composite performs well for elevated decks, it presents limitations at ground level.

Composite requires a supporting structure of joists and beams, which adds cost and complexity compared to pavers laid on gravel. The gap beneath the decking creates space for debris accumulation, insect nesting, and moisture problems.

Composite also expands and contracts significantly with temperature changes. A 16-foot composite deck board can expand up to three-quarters of an inch between winter and summer. This movement requires careful gap planning that creates a less finished appearance than tight-jointed paver installations.

For ground-level patios in Nashville, stick with masonry materials designed for direct earth contact. Reserve composite for elevated decks where its lightweight and wood-free benefits make more sense.

Installation Matters as Much as Material

Even the best patio materials Nashville suppliers stock will fail if installed incorrectly. Proper base preparation, drainage planning, and joint execution determine long-term performance.

The base should extend six inches beyond the finished patio edge in all directions. Excavation depth depends on material thickness but typically ranges from eight to twelve inches to accommodate base gravel, bedding sand, and the patio surface.

Grade the base to slope away from structures at a minimum two percent pitch. This equals a quarter-inch drop per foot of patio depth. Proper slope prevents water from pooling or flowing toward your home’s foundation.

Edge restraint keeps pavers from spreading over time. Commercial-grade plastic or aluminum edging anchored with spikes creates invisible borders that maintain alignment. Concrete edges work for more formal installations.

For projects combining hardscapes with pools or water features, coordinate grading to direct runoff appropriately. Poor drainage undermines even the most durable materials.

Matching Materials to Your Complete Outdoor Space

Your patio rarely exists in isolation. Most connect to pools, outdoor kitchens, fire features, or seating walls. Material selection should complement these elements while maintaining freeze-thaw durability.

If you are planning a pool project, coordinate patio materials with coping and deck surfaces for visual continuity. Natural stone pairs beautifully with both fiberglass pools and concrete pools, while concrete pavers offer more budget flexibility without sacrificing durability.

Outdoor kitchen surrounds benefit from porcelain’s stain resistance and easy cleaning. Spilled oils, sauces, and wine wipe away without leaving permanent marks. The same porcelain used for the patio can extend to kitchen surrounds, creating seamless integration.

When working with sloped yards, your patio material choice should coordinate with retaining walls that create level outdoor living space. Many paver manufacturers offer matching wall block systems that ensure color and texture consistency across all hardscape elements.

Frequently Asked Questions

How long do different patio materials last in Nashville’s climate?

Properly installed concrete pavers typically last 25 to 40 years, while natural stone like bluestone or granite can exceed 50 years with minimal maintenance. Porcelain pavers often outlast both with expected lifespans beyond 60 years. Poured concrete usually requires replacement or major repair within 20 to 30 years due to cracking.

Do I need to seal my patio in Nashville?

It depends on the material. Porcelain never requires sealing. Concrete pavers benefit from sealer application every three to five years to enhance color and resist stains. Natural stone needs sealing every two to three years, with travertine requiring annual treatment. Poured and stamped concrete should be resealed every two to three years to prevent moisture infiltration and surface degradation.

What is the most cost-effective patio material for freeze-thaw durability?

Concrete pavers offer the best balance of upfront cost, durability, and low maintenance for Nashville’s freeze-thaw cycles. Quality pavers typically cost 30 to 50 percent less than natural stone while providing comparable longevity. Though poured concrete costs less initially, factor in higher crack repair probability and more frequent sealing requirements over the patio’s lifetime.

Can I install a patio myself or should I hire professionals?

Base preparation requires precision grading, proper compaction equipment, and drainage knowledge that most DIY installers lack. Improper base work leads to settling, uneven surfaces, and premature failure regardless of material quality. Professional installation costs more initially but ensures the investment performs as expected for decades. Complex projects integrating pools, kitchens, or significant grading absolutely require experienced contractors.

Which patio material stays coolest in summer?

Porcelain pavers reflect more solar heat than they absorb, staying significantly cooler than concrete or dark natural stone. Light-colored travertine also remains relatively cool due to its porous structure and reflective surface. Dark granite and concrete absorb the most heat and can become uncomfortable for bare feet during peak summer afternoons. Color matters as much as material, with lighter shades always running cooler than dark options.
